30 y.o. c/o pruritic hives over chest/ arms but denies SOB, difficulty swallowing. Reports family hx allergic rhinitis, & asthma. Which of the following interventions is most appropriate? 
A. Perform thorough History 
B. Prescribe PO antihistamine such as benadryl 25mg PO QD 
C. IM Epinephrine 1:1000 STAT 
D. Call 911 - Answer--A. Take a thorough history prior to prescribing medications: find cause of rash. No airway difficulty/ swallowing so no need for 911

Cells become specialized through the process of - Answer--differentiation or maturation 
Eight specialized cellular functions are - Answer--movement, conductivity, metabolic absorption, secretion, excretion, respiration, reproduction, and communication 
Eukaryotic cells consist of - Answer--the plasma membrane, the cytoplasm, and intracellular organelles 
What is the nucleus? - Answer--the largest membrane-bound organelle and found in the cell's center

Eukaryotes - Answer--have membrane-bound intracellular compartments (organelles) that includes a well defined nucleus. cells that bind with DNA and are involved in supercoiling of DNA 
prokaryotes - Answer--no organelles, nuclear material is not encased by a nuclear membrane. Nuclei of cells carry genetic information in a single circular chromosome and they lack histones

The physician orders 1,500 mg of a medication to be given over 90 minutes. The available medication is 1,500 mg/250 mL. You will set the pump to deliver ____mL/hr.(round to the nearest whole number) - Answer--167 
Your patient is receiving 37.5 mcg of a medication. This is equivalent to _____ mg of medication. (record your answer using two decimal places) - Answer--0.04

In extubating an Endtroacheal tube, what needs to be reported immedatiely? - Answer--stridor 
Why is stridor bad? - Answer--it means that there is an obstruction or edema in airway 
What is common in heart rate in a patient with low fluid volume (hypovolemia)? - Answer--usually greater than 110- to compensate for the low bp 
What is normal urine gravity? - Answer--1.000 - 1.030 
What is the role of positive pressure? - Answer--to promote lung expansion and stabilize chest
